Abstract

This research aims to evaluate the effectiveness of anti-bullying socialization programs based on Islamic values implemented by human rights mobilization communities in Samarinda City. This program involves collaboration between schools, parents, and the community in preventing bullying and strengthening the morale of elementary school children. The methods used are mixed-methods, which include interviews, observations, questionnaires, and literature studies. The results of the study showed that after three months of program implementation, there was a 35% decrease in bullying incidents. A total of 75% of students reported an increased understanding of the impact of bullying, and 60% were able to identify bullying behaviors around them. In addition, parental participation in school activities increased from 45% to 78%, which indicates improved communication and better collaboration between schools and families. This program also succeeded in introducing Islamic values such as rahmah and ukhuwah in student interaction, which had a positive impact on strengthening their morals. These findings show that collaboration between schools, parents, and the community is very effective in shaping children's character and reducing bullying behavior, and underscores the importance of religion-based moral education in supporting children's character development.
